We consider intersections in eleven dimensions involving Kaluza-Klein monopoles and Brinkmann waves. Besides these purely gravitational configurations we also construct solutions to the equations of motion that involve additional M2-and M5-branes. The maximal number of independent objects in these intersections is nine, and such maximal configurations, when reduced to two dimensions, give rise to a zero-brane solution with dilaton coupling a = −4/9.

متن کاملPolarization of the Microwave Background in Defect Models
We compute the polarization power spectra for global strings, monopoles, textures and nontopological textures, and compare them to inflationary models. We find that topological defect models predict a significant (∼ 1μK) contribution to magnetic type polarization on degree angular scales, which is produced by the large vector component of the defect source.
